Semi-dry Pirosmani red wine – Kakheti
Discover the Pirosmani red wine, made from 100% Saperavi grapes from the prestigious Kakheti region. The hand-picked grapes, harvested at optimum ripeness, undergo a special alcoholic fermentation on the skins, supported by natural yeast cultures. The fermentation is stopped by cooling when the ideal residual sweetness is reached in order to preserve the natural sweetness and freshness of the wine.
Aroma & taste: This dark red wine seduces with the intense aroma of ripe cherries. On the palate it is young and full-bodied, with a pronounced sweet fruit, soft textures and spicy nuances. The balanced aftertaste of blackberries rounds off the taste experience.
Serving suggestion: Enjoy this red wine at temperatures of +14°C to +18°C, ideal with sweets, fruits and desserts.
Sugar: 9-12 g/l
Alcohol: 12.0 Vol.%

Dry Rkatsiteli Kvevri White Wine
Discover the Rkatsiteli Kvevri white wine from the renowned Kakheti wine region. This wine is hand-picked and destemmed at optimal ripeness. The grapes ferment whole for about three weeks in the Quevri, followed by malolactic fermentation and three months of maceration. After clarification, the wine matures for a few more months in stainless steel tanks.
Aroma: Intense with aromas of white and dried fruits as well as fine herbs.
Palate: Complex and mineral, finishes with ripe tannins.

Dry Rkatsiteli white wine
Experience the Georgian classic Rkatsiteli, one of the most widely cultivated white grape varieties in Georgia. The literal translation "Red Horn" reflects the robust nature of this vine, which is characterized by its natural resistance to phylloxera.
This Rkatsiteli captivates with its light straw-yellow color and a harmonious, fruity taste. The aromas of peach and apricot are complemented by delicate floral notes. On the palate, the wine is light and crisp, with yellow fruit aromas and a lively acidity that culminates in a fresh finish.
Best served at a temperature of 14°C to 18°C as an aperitif, with grilled fish or fresh salads.
Technical details:
- Sugar: 0-4 g/l
- Alcohol: 13.5 Vol. %
- Composition: 100% Rkatsiteli
- Growing area: Kakheti

Dry Tsinandali white wine
The Tsinandali white wine comes from the renowned Tsinandali wine-growing region in Kakheti and combines the grape varieties Rkatsiteli (95%) and Mtsvane (5%). Its bright straw-yellow color already foreshadows the elegance of this wine.
Aroma & Taste
On the palate, the Tsinandali is full-bodied and harmonious, with a complexity reminiscent of banana and tropical fruits. The fresh citrus notes in the finish are complemented by subtle oak notes, giving the wine a perfect balance. Herbal and floral aromas round out the bouquet.
Dietary recommendations
Ideal with salads, grilled vegetables, fish and chicken with citrus fruit sauce.
Serving temperature
Optimal at 14°C to 18°C.
The Tsinandali white wine (13.0% vol., 0-4 g/l sugar) is an elegant and complex companion for a variety of occasions.
